From 6b82788180258c672529abbbe605747e573cccf3 Mon Sep 17 00:00:00 2001
From: Johannes Pfeifer <jpfeifer@gmx.de>
Date: Sun, 9 Oct 2016 22:16:26 +0200
Subject: [PATCH] Display reason for mode_check-problems when debugging is
enabled
---
matlab/mode_check.m | 3 +++
1 file changed, 3 insertions(+)
diff --git a/matlab/mode_check.m b/matlab/mode_check.m
index b7221961c..8d216bcbf 100644
--- a/matlab/mode_check.m
+++ b/matlab/mode_check.m
@@ -145,6 +145,9 @@ for plt = 1:nbplt,
y(i,1) = fval;
else
y(i,1) = NaN;
+ if DynareOptions.debug
+ fprintf('mode_check:: could not solve model for parameter %s at value %4.3f, error code: %u\n',name,z(i),info(1))
+ end
end
if DynareOptions.mode_check.nolik==0
lnprior = priordens(xx,BayesInfo.pshape,BayesInfo.p6,BayesInfo.p7,BayesInfo.p3,BayesInfo.p4);
--
GitLab